首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Scala ListBuffer的Kotlin等价物

Scala ListBuffer是一种可变的列表数据结构,它可以在常量时间内在任意位置插入和删除元素。它是Scala语言中的一个集合类,用于存储元素的有序序列。

ListBuffer和Kotlin之间没有直接的等价物,因为它们属于不同的编程语言。但是,Kotlin提供了类似的数据结构,比如MutableList,可以实现类似的功能。

ListBuffer的优势包括:

  1. 动态增长:ListBuffer可以根据需要动态增加容量,无需事先指定大小。
  2. 高效的插入和删除操作:ListBuffer支持在列表的任意位置进行元素的插入和删除操作,并且具有接近常量时间的复杂度。
  3. 保持顺序:ListBuffer按照插入的顺序存储元素,可以保持元素的顺序性。

ListBuffer的应用场景包括:

  1. 数据收集和处理:ListBuffer适用于需要收集和处理大量元素的场景,例如日志分析、数据挖掘等。
  2. 缓存管理:ListBuffer可以作为缓存数据的临时存储容器,方便高效地进行数据的增删操作。
  3. 算法实现:ListBuffer的高效插入和删除操作使其在算法实现中有广泛的应用,例如图遍历、排序算法等。

腾讯云提供了云原生的产品和服务,其中包括与云计算相关的一些解决方案和工具。您可以了解腾讯云的云原生产品和服务,以满足您的需求。详细的产品介绍和相关链接请参考腾讯云的官方文档:

腾讯云云原生产品与服务介绍

请注意,本回答只涉及腾讯云相关的产品和服务,不包括其他云计算品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

14分37秒

155-尚硅谷-Scala核心编程-ListBuffer的使用.avi

6分57秒

003_尚硅谷_Scala_Scala概述(二)_Scala和Java的关系

1分56秒

Scala 的基础语法

1分44秒

Scala 的方法与函数

6分12秒

150-尚硅谷-Scala核心编程-Java的List转scala的Buffer.avi

15分46秒

007_尚硅谷_Scala_Scala环境搭建(三)_Scala编译结果的反编译深入分析

13分23秒

014-尚硅谷-Scala核心编程-Scala变量的基本使用.avi

7分45秒

080-尚硅谷-Scala核心编程-Scala包的基本使用.avi

15分36秒

081-尚硅谷-Scala核心编程-Scala包的特点说明.avi

7分39秒

096-尚硅谷-Scala核心编程-Scala的继承快速入门.avi

23分50秒

015-尚硅谷-Scala核心编程-Scala变量的注意事项.avi

18分34秒

087-尚硅谷-Scala核心编程-Scala包的可见性讲解.avi

领券